Brand, Size, Shape, gel technology, profiles and more!<\/h5>\n<h3 data-pm-slice=\"1 3 []\"><strong>Types of Implant Fill Materials<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Breast implants come with different types of filling materials, each offering unique characteristics in terms of feel, cohesiveness, and longevity.<\/p>\n<h4><strong>1. Saline Implants<\/strong><\/h4>\n<ul data-spread=\"false\">\n<li><strong>Fill Material:<\/strong> Sterile saltwater solution.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Cohesiveness:<\/strong> Less cohesive than silicone; may feel firmer.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Advantages:<\/strong> If ruptured, the body absorbs the saline safely.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Drawbacks:<\/strong> Higher risk of rippling and less natural feel compared to silicone.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><strong>2. Silicone Gel Implants<\/strong><\/h4>\n<ul data-spread=\"false\">\n<li><strong>Fill Material:<\/strong> Soft, medical-grade silicone gel.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Cohesiveness:<\/strong> More cohesive than saline, providing a natural feel.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Advantages:<\/strong> Mimics the feel of natural breast tissue and is less likely to ripple.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Drawbacks:<\/strong> If ruptured, requires imaging (MRI or ultrasound) for detection.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h4><strong>3. Silicone &#8220;Gummy Bear&#8221; Implants<\/strong><\/h4>\n<ul data-spread=\"false\">\n<li><strong>Fill Material:<\/strong> Highly cohesive silicone gel.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Cohesiveness:<\/strong> Retains shape even when cut, offering the highest firmness and durability.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Advantages:<\/strong> Minimal risk of leakage and superior shape retention.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Drawbacks:<\/strong> More expensive and requires a larger incision for insertion.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><strong>Implant Profiles (Projection Levels)<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p><strong>Implant profile<\/strong>\u00a0refers to the\u00a0<em>overall shape<\/em>\u00a0of an implant is determined by three dimensions: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Base diameter or width<\/li>\n<li>Volume<\/li>\n<li>Projection<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Implants come in different projection levels, which determine how far they extend from the chest:<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li><strong>Low Profile<\/strong>\n<ul>\n<li>Broad base with minimal projection.<\/li>\n<li>Best for patients with wider chests who want a subtle look.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<li><strong>Moderate Profile<\/strong>\n<ul>\n<li>Balanced base width and projection.<\/li>\n<li>Provides a natural shape and is a popular choice.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<li><strong>High &amp; Ultra-High Profile<\/strong>\n<ul>\n<li>Narrower base but greater projection.<\/li>\n<li>Creates a fuller, more dramatic look, enhancing upper breast fullness.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-3116\" src=\"https:\/\/www.drdanamd.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/breast-implant-profiles-memorial-plastic-surgery.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"476\" height=\"249\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.drdanamd.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/breast-implant-profiles-memorial-plastic-surgery.jpg 476w, https:\/\/www.drdanamd.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/breast-implant-profiles-memorial-plastic-surgery-300x157.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 476px) 100vw, 476px\" \/><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3><strong>Implant Shapes<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>The shape of an implant determines how volume is distributed in the breast:<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li><strong>Round Implants<\/strong>\n<ul>\n<li>Even fullness throughout, including the upper part of the breast.<\/li>\n<li>Ideal for patients wanting a more enhanced and lifted appearance.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<li><strong>Teardrop (Anatomical) Implants<\/strong>\n<ul>\n<li>More volume at the bottom, tapering towards the top.<\/li>\n<li>Mimics the natural slope of the breast for a subtle, natural look.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one  wp-image-3117\" src=\"https:\/\/www.drdanamd.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/image-3.png\" alt=\"\" width=\"383\" height=\"185\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.drdanamd.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/image-3.png 323w, https:\/\/www.drdanamd.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/image-3-300x145.png 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 383px) 100vw, 383px\" \/><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3><strong>Choosing the Right Implant<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>The best implant for each patient depends on:<br \/>\n\u2714 <strong>Body structure<\/strong> \u2013 Chest width and existing breast tissue.<br \/>\n\u2714 <strong>Aesthetic goals<\/strong> \u2013 Subtle vs. dramatic enhancement.<br \/>\n\u2714 <strong>Skin elasticity<\/strong> \u2013 Determines how well the implant settles.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h3 data-pm-slice=\"1 1 []\">Comparing Breast Implant Brands: Sientra, Natrelle, and Motiva<\/h3>\n<p>Breast augmentation remains one of the most popular cosmetic procedures worldwide, offering patients a chance to enhance their body contours and boost their confidence.
